10.3 Guidelines and Manufacturer´s Declaration - Immunity
The ATMOS Patient chair M2 is intended for use in the electromagnetic environment specifi ed below. The customer
or user of the ATMOS Patient chair M2 should ensure that it is used in such an environment.

Electromagnetic
Environment - Guidance
Mains power quality should be that
of a typical commercial or hospital
environment. If the user of the
ATMOS Patient chair M2 demands
continued function even in case of
interruptions of the energy supply,
it is recommended to supply the
ATMOS Patient chair M2 from an
uninterruptible current supply or a
battery.
